Ingredients for 4 servings:
- 400g spaghetti
- 500 g minced meat
- 300 ml tomato ketchup
- 1 tbsp margarine
- 1 tbsp flour
- 1 egg(s)
- some breadcrumbs
- salt and pepper
- Paprika powder, sweet
Instructions
Working time approx. 25 minutes; Total time approx. 25 minutes
Knead the minced meat with the egg and breadcrumbs and season with salt, pepper, and paprika. Mix the meat mixture thoroughly and then form it into small meatballs. Heat the margarine in a pan and fry the meatballs in it. In the meantime, cook the spaghetti until al dente. When the meatballs are done, remove them from the pan and keep warm. Add the flour to the frying fat, stir with a whisk, and slowly add enough water until a light, creamy sauce forms. Continue stirring, simmer briefly, then stir in the tomato ketchup, season with salt, pepper, and paprika, and bring back to a boil. Drain the spaghetti and serve with the meatballs and the sauce. We like to serve it with cucumber salad. It’s a dish from my childhood that my children still love to eat today.
